The third Test played between India and Australia at Gabba has also ended. After the completion of three out of five Test matches, the series is tied at 1-1. Meaning now Team India will have to win both the remaining matches. Not just because the series has to be won. But also for tickets to the WTC final. If India has to play the final of the WTC next year, then the easiest way for it is by winning the remaining two Tests against Australia. This is the reason why after the end of the Gabba Test and before the fourth Test against Australia in Melbourne, Rohit Sharma was seen asking for an update on a big arrow in his quiver i.e.
Mohammed Shami.Team India captain Rohit Sharma has sought an update from NCA regarding Shami before the fourth Test against Australia. He said, I think now is the right time. This is the right time to know what is the latest update on Shami? The Indian captain said that he wants someone from NCA to come forward and give accurate information in this matter.
Rohit talked about Shami in the press conference held in Brisbane. While asking for an update, he also said that he knows that Shami is currently playing domestic cricket.
But at the same time he also has some problems related to his knee. Rohit said that you do not want any player to come to Australia from India and then be out of the match due to injury. He told the journalists that you all also know what happens in that kind of situation?Rohit further said that the Indian team definitely wants Shami to return soon but it is in no mood to take any risk on him. In such a situation, everything will depend on the decision of NCA. He said that not 100 percent, we have to be 200 percent sure, only then we can take a chance of feeding Shami.
